hi,

I finally got CVS to work. So I'll soon upload the bug database to CVS. I 
think I will create a separate branch lilypond_2_2 for bugs in that version.

Some questions have popped up:
1. What is the easiest way of invoking lilypond directly from the source tree? 
I.e. how do I easily make ./scripts/out/lilypond 
invoke ./lily/out/lilypond-bin instead of /usr/bin/lilypond-bin, and how do I 
make it use ./scm/, etc. instead of /usr/share/lilypond/2.2.0/scm, etc?
(this is pretty crucial since I'll have to maintain bug databases for both 2.2 
and 2.3; so I'll sometimes have to switch between versions just to compile a 
single .ly file).

2. I'm about to create the new branch now. I don't want to screw anything up, 
so can somebody please verify that the following command line is what I 
should do?
~/lily-bugs$ cvs -z3 -d address@hidden:/cvsroot/lilypond import 
lily-bugs 1.1.1 lilypond_2_2

(I beleive that this would create a new module lily-bugs 
under /cvsroot/lilypond, containing all files in the current working 
directory.. is this true?)
